O R D E R

Petition filed under Section 439 Cr.P.C.

2.

The petitioners apprehend that they will be arrested by the police on the allegation that they have committed the offences under sections 323, 324 and 498A of Indian Penal Code.

3.

The accusation is that they assaulted the wife of the first petitioner and subjected her to cruelty. 4.

Heard.

5.

The prosecution has no case that the first informant sustained any serious injuries. It appears that restoration of harmony to the family is not impossible. So I am inclined to grant the prayer of the petitioners for anticipatory bail.

In the result, this application is allowed.

1.

The petitioners shall be released on bail after interrogation on their executing a bond for Rs.25,000/- (Rupees Twenty five thousand only) each with two solvent sureties for the like sum each if they are arrested by the

B.A. No.3028 of 2015 police in connection with this case.

2.

They shall appear before the investigating officer for interrogation if they are so required by him in writing. 3.

They shall appear before the investigating officer between 10 a.m to 11 a.m on every Wednesday for four months or till the final report is filed whichever is earlier. 4.

They shall not get themselves involved in any other criminal case while they are on bail.

5.

They shall not intimidate or attempt to influence the witnesses.

6.

They shall not destroy or tamper with evidence. 7.

They shall not harass the defacto complainant or her relatives.

In case of violation of any of the above conditions, the learned Magistrate is empowered to cancel the bail in accordance with law.
